What is a Computer Vision job?

A Computer Vision job involves developing algorithms and systems that enable computers to interpret and process visual data from the world. Professionals in this field work on tasks such as object detection, image recognition, and video analysis using machine learning and deep learning techniques. They collaborate with data scientists, software engineers, and researchers to build applications in fields like healthcare, autonomous vehicles, and augmented reality. Strong programming skills in Python, knowledge of frameworks like OpenCV and TensorFlow, and experience with image processing techniques are essential for success in this role.

What are some typical projects or tasks a Computer Vision professional might work on?

Computer Vision professionals commonly work on projects like designing algorithms for image classification, object detection, facial recognition, or scene understanding, often leveraging deep learning models. Daily responsibilities may include data preprocessing, developing and testing models, deploying solutions on cloud or edge devices, and evaluating performance against benchmarks. Collaboration is frequent with data scientists, software engineers, and product managers to integrate vision models into software applications or products. These projects can span various industries such as healthcare, automotive, retail, and security, providing both technical challenges and opportunities for impactful innovation.

What are the key skills and qualifications needed to thrive in the Computer Vision position, and why are they important?

To thrive in a Computer Vision role, you need strong programming skills (especially in Python and C++), a solid understanding of mathematics (linear algebra, probability, and statistics), machine learning fundamentals, and typically a relevant degree in Computer Science or a related field. Proficiency with deep learning frameworks like TensorFlow, PyTorch, and OpenCV, as well as experience with image processing tools, is highly valued, and certifications in AI or data science are beneficial. Analytical thinking, creative problem-solving, and effective teamwork and communication skills help you excel. These abilities are crucial for developing innovative real-world computer vision solutions and collaborating across multidisciplinary teams.
